Burney Rd Tract. Welcome to one of the most pristine areas of Bladen CountyWhite Oak. This exceptional 67-acre tract offers everything a landowner, hunter, or outdoor enthusiast could ask for. With over 1,000 feet of road frontage and at least 10 acres of soil along Burney Road suitable for septic, this property is perfectly positioned for a homesite, hunting retreat, or family compound. Sportsmen will appreciate the abundant wildlife and diverse habitat. Phillips Creek winds through the center of the property. You will also find a 1.2 -acre duck impoundment with a flashboard riser that allows you to maintain your impoundment throughout the year. Deer, ducks, turkeys, and bear are all plentiful. Its natural location between what Bakers Lake(now owned by the State) and the Cape Fear River places it directly in a prime flight path for waterfowl. The tract includes: 10 acres of Longleaf Pines planted in 2019 on a 10x10 spacingnow ready for pine straw production. 20 acres of Containerized Loblolly Pines planted in 2019 on a 7x10 spacing. The remaining acreage is a 20-year-old natural mix of pine and hardwood timber with value. All in Land Use All Property Corners are well established and have been maintained by the owner. No deed restrictions leave your options wide open A well-established road provides access throughout most of the property, with only a small area at the rear falling within the FEMA floodplain. This is a rare opportunity to own a versatile, wildlife-rich, and investment-ready property in a highly desirable part of Bladen County. 32 miles to gate on All American 25 miles Downtown Fayetteville 17 miles to Elizabethtown 20 miles to Lumberton
